Buechele, No. 25 SMU outlast East Carolina

-

DALLAS — Shane Buechele threw five touchdown passes, Xavier Jones broke one of Eric Dickerson’s school records and Southern Methodist outscored East Carolina 59-51 on Saturday.

SMU (9-1, 5-1 American Athletic) played from ahead and kept it that way in a game with more than 1,000 combined yards.

Tight end Kylen Granson caught three touchdown passes, including a 31-yarder on fourthand-20 with SMU leading 45-44 midway through the fourth quarter. Granson, a transfer from Rice, had seven receptions for 138 yards.

Buechele threw for 414 yards.

Jones, who ran for 157 yards, had three touchdowns. He has 20 total touchdowns, one more than Pro Football Hall of Famer Dickerson had in 1981.

NICHOLLS ST. 48 HOUSTON BAPTIST 27

Julien Gums ran for three touchdowns and Chase Fourcade passed for two as the Colonels won at Thibodeaux, La.

Gums carried 22 times for 104 yards. Fourcade was 17 of 23 for 294 yards.

PRAIRIE VIEW A&M 37 ARKANSAS-PINE BLUFF 20

Dawonya Tucker ran for 91 yards and three touchdowns as the Panthers won at home.

SAM HOUSTON ST. 24 ABILENE CHRISTIAN 10

Eric Schmid passed for 280 yards and a touchdown as the Bearkats overcame a 10-0 deficit to win at Abilene.

Ife Adeyi caught eight passes for 197 yards and two TDs for Sam Houston (6-4, 5-2 SLC).

STEPHEN F. AUSTIN ST. 31 INCARNATE WORD 24

Xavier Gipson caught four passes for 132 yards and scored the go-ahead touchdown to help the Lumberjack­s win at Nacogdoche­s..

LOUISIANA TECH 52 NORTH TEXAS 17

J’Mar Smith passed for 263 yards and a touchdown, and the Bulldogs remained unbeaten in Conference USA play with a win at Ruston, La.

CHARLOTTE 28, UTEP 21

Chris Reynolds threw for a career-high 354 yards and two touchdowns and added 91 yards rushing to help the 49ers win at El Paso.

UTSA 24, OLD DOMINION 23

Lowell Narcisse threw an 11-yard touchdown pass to Carlos Strickland to tie, and Hunter Duplessis knocked in the winning extra point as as the Roadrunner­s won at Norfolk, Va..

TEXAS STATE 30 SOUTH ALABAMA 28

Tyler Vitt accounted for 415 total yards and three touchdowns as the Bobcats held on for the win at San Marcos.

NORTHWESTE­RN ST. 34, LAMAR 13

Shelton Eppler threw four touchdown passes to lead the host Demons to a win at Natchitoch­es, La.
